The brand new instruction solution, based on machine Discovering, is termed curiosity-driven red teaming (CRT) and relies on working with an AI to deliver significantly dangerous and destructive prompts that you could potentially inquire an AI chatbot. These prompts are then used to detect ways to filter out perilous articles.

Next, if the enterprise wishes to lift the bar by testing resilience towards certain threats, it's best to leave the door open up for sourcing these abilities externally depending on the precise danger versus which the enterprise wishes to test its resilience. For example, while in the banking field, the enterprise may want to carry out a crimson crew exercising to check the ecosystem all around automated teller device (ATM) protection, wherever a specialised source with relevant knowledge might be needed. In Yet another circumstance, an business might have to check its Software program being a Provider (SaaS) Option, wherever cloud stability encounter can be vital.

Red teaming is really a website Main driver of resilience, however it might also pose serious challenges to protection groups. Two of the most significant worries are the expense and period of time it requires to conduct a red-group training. Therefore, at an average Business, pink-team engagements tend to occur periodically at most effective, which only presents insight into your Corporation’s cybersecurity at a single position in time.

The principle goal of penetration assessments is to establish exploitable vulnerabilities and attain entry to a technique. However, in a very red-crew exercise, the purpose is to obtain unique devices or information by emulating a real-world adversary and using practices and tactics through the entire assault chain, including privilege escalation and exfiltration.
